Output 7d315f6d60871d3ec7181789e9f4905963a985e7e4a57d2ee93062079bedb925:2

value
10804791816
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ffc43bb9ae8baa755b2422b48a52d353eb44a1d3 OP_EQUALVERIFY OP_CHECKSIG
address
1QKNPSr38NzrgdaXTKdsmCKL4iiUBrjkPE
transaction
7d315f6d60871d3ec7181789e9f4905963a985e7e4a57d2ee93062079bedb925
spent
true